Abstract

This study was carried to identify whether acupuncture of several acupuncture points can affect the brain and to observe which aspects appear in EEG mapping, using electroencephalography. Those results are as follows ; 1. The pattern of resting computerized EEG map in intact human is appered normal 2. Each Acupuncture in Kwan Weon or Jog Sam Ri meridian points bring about the increase in $\theta,\;\alpha-wave$ activity and at various area of the cerebrium and the decrease in $\delta,\;\beta-wave$ activity. It strands to reason that brain function is elevated On the other hand , synchronous acupuncture bring about the decrease of brain function in view of the decrease of $\delta,\;\theta-wave$ activity at frontal area, and the unstable brain state in view of the increase of $\beta-wave$ activity. 3. Acupuncture in Hyeon Jong meridian point bring about the increase of $\delta,\;\theta-wave$ activity at frontal area and $\beta-wave$ activity at temporal area. From these we deduce that brain function is declined and brain is unstable. Synchronous acupuncture with other meridian points reversly showed that brain function is elevated. 4. Synchronous acupuncture in Kwan Weon , Jog Sam Ri, Hyeon Jong bring about the decrease of the brain function and the unstable brain state, showing the pattern of increased $\delta,\;\theta-wave$ activity at frontal, parietal area, and increased $\beta-wave$ activity at temporal area.
